body[data-v-b39655ce],html[data-v-b39655ce]{margin:0;padding:0;scroll-snap-stop:always;width:100%}*[data-v-b39655ce]{box-sizing:border-box}.h1[data-v-b39655ce]{color:#000;font-family:Montserrat,You Se;font-size:48px}@media screen and (min-width:340px){.h1[data-v-b39655ce]{font-size:64px}}@media screen and (min-width:540px){.h1[data-v-b39655ce]{font-size:72px}}.h2[data-v-b39655ce]{color:#000;font-family:Montserrat,You Se;font-size:36px}@media screen and (min-width:340px){.h2[data-v-b39655ce]{font-size:48px}}@media screen and (min-width:540px){.h2[data-v-b39655ce]{font-size:64px}}.h3[data-v-b39655ce]{color:#000;font-family:Montserrat,You Se;font-size:28px;font-weight:800}@media screen and (min-width:340px){.h3[data-v-b39655ce]{font-size:36px}}@media screen and (min-width:540px){.h3[data-v-b39655ce]{font-size:48px}}.h4[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-size:24px;font-weight:700}@media screen and (min-width:340px){.h4[data-v-b39655ce]{font-size:28px}}@media screen and (min-width:540px){.h4[data-v-b39655ce]{font-size:36px}}.h5[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-size:22px;font-weight:700}@media screen and (min-width:340px){.h5[data-v-b39655ce]{font-size:24px}}@media screen and (min-width:540px){.h5[data-v-b39655ce]{font-size:28px}}.h6[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-size:20px;font-weight:700}@media screen and (min-width:340px){.h6[data-v-b39655ce]{font-size:22px}}@media screen and (min-width:540px){.h6[data-v-b39655ce]{font-size:24px}}.subtitle1[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-size:18px;font-weight:700}@media screen and (min-width:340px){.subtitle1[data-v-b39655ce]{font-size:20px}}@media screen and (min-width:540px){.subtitle1[data-v-b39655ce]{font-size:22px}}.subtitle2[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-size:16px;font-weight:700}@media screen and (min-width:340px){.subtitle2[data-v-b39655ce]{font-size:18px}}@media screen and (min-width:540px){.subtitle2[data-v-b39655ce]{font-size:20px}}.body1[data-v-b39655ce]{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:14px}@media screen and (min-width:340px){.body1[data-v-b39655ce]{font-size:16px}}@media screen and (min-width:540px){.body1[data-v-b39655ce]{font-size:18px}}.body2[data-v-b39655ce]{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:12px}@media screen and (min-width:340px){.body2[data-v-b39655ce]{font-size:14px}}@media screen and (min-width:540px){.body2[data-v-b39655ce]{font-size:16px}}.highlight[data-v-b39655ce]{color:#f8a51b!important;font-weight:700}.card[data-v-b39655ce],.v-select__content[data-v-b39655ce]{border-radius:20px!important;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a!important}.card *[data-v-b39655ce],.v-select__content *[data-v-b39655ce]{color:#5e5e5e;font-family:Zen Maru,Han Rounded;font-weight:700}.card .v-list-item--active *[data-v-b39655ce],.v-select__content .v-list-item--active *[data-v-b39655ce]{color:#000!important}.v-list[data-v-b39655ce]{background-color:transparent;padding:5px 0}.v-list a[data-v-b39655ce]{border-radius:50px;margin:5px 10px}.c-section-subheader[data-v-b39655ce]{background-color:#f8a51b;border-radius:16px;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a;padding:6px 30px 8px;width:-moz-fit-content;width:fit-content}@media screen and (min-width:800px){.c-section-subheader[data-v-b39655ce]{border-radius:20px;padding:8px 45px 10px}}.c-section-subheader h2[data-v-b39655ce]{color:#fff;font-weight:900;line-height:120%;text-align:left}@keyframes fadeOut-b39655ce{0%{opacity:0;transform:scale(.5)}to{opacity:1;transform:scale(1)}}a[data-v-b39655ce]{color:#000;font-family:Zen Maru,Han Rounded;font-family:Montserrat,You Se;font-size:16px;text-decoration:none}body,html{margin:0;padding:0;scroll-snap-stop:always;width:100%}*{box-sizing:border-box}.h1{color:#000;font-family:Montserrat,You Se;font-size:48px}@media screen and (min-width:340px){.h1{font-size:64px}}@media screen and (min-width:540px){.h1{font-size:72px}}.h2{color:#000;font-family:Montserrat,You Se;font-size:36px}@media screen and (min-width:340px){.h2{font-size:48px}}@media screen and (min-width:540px){.h2{font-size:64px}}.h3{color:#000;font-family:Montserrat,You Se;font-size:28px;font-weight:800}@media screen and (min-width:340px){.h3{font-size:36px}}@media screen and (min-width:540px){.h3{font-size:48px}}.h4{color:#000;font-family:Zen Maru,Han Rounded;font-size:24px;font-weight:700}@media screen and (min-width:340px){.h4{font-size:28px}}@media screen and (min-width:540px){.h4{font-size:36px}}.h5{color:#000;font-family:Zen Maru,Han Rounded;font-size:22px;font-weight:700}@media screen and (min-width:340px){.h5{font-size:24px}}@media screen and (min-width:540px){.h5{font-size:28px}}.h6{color:#000;font-family:Zen Maru,Han Rounded;font-size:20px;font-weight:700}@media screen and (min-width:340px){.h6{font-size:22px}}@media screen and (min-width:540px){.h6{font-size:24px}}.subtitle1{color:#000;font-family:Zen Maru,Han Rounded;font-size:18px;font-weight:700}@media screen and (min-width:340px){.subtitle1{font-size:20px}}@media screen and (min-width:540px){.subtitle1{font-size:22px}}.subtitle2{color:#000;font-family:Zen Maru,Han Rounded;font-size:16px;font-weight:700}@media screen and (min-width:340px){.subtitle2{font-size:18px}}@media screen and (min-width:540px){.subtitle2{font-size:20px}}.body1{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:14px}@media screen and (min-width:340px){.body1{font-size:16px}}@media screen and (min-width:540px){.body1{font-size:18px}}.body2{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:12px}@media screen and (min-width:340px){.body2{font-size:14px}}@media screen and (min-width:540px){.body2{font-size:16px}}.highlight{color:#f8a51b!important;font-weight:700}.card,.v-select__content{border-radius:20px!important;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a!important}.card *,.v-select__content *{color:#5e5e5e;font-family:Zen Maru,Han Rounded;font-weight:700}.card .v-list-item--active *,.v-select__content .v-list-item--active *{color:#000!important}.v-list{background-color:transparent;padding:5px 0}.v-list a{border-radius:50px;margin:5px 10px}.c-section-subheader{background-color:#f8a51b;border-radius:16px;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a;padding:6px 30px 8px;width:-moz-fit-content;width:fit-content}@media screen and (min-width:800px){.c-section-subheader{border-radius:20px;padding:8px 45px 10px}}.c-section-subheader h2{color:#fff;font-weight:900;line-height:120%;text-align:left}@keyframes fadeOut{0%{opacity:0;transform:scale(.5)}to{opacity:1;transform:scale(1)}}@keyframes slide-left{0%{transform:translate(5px)}to{transform:translate(0)}}.c-header .header nav .active:after,.c-header .header nav .nav-button:hover:after,.link-active:after{animation:slide-left .1s ease-in-out forwards;background-color:#fff;border-radius:50px;bottom:-2.5px;box-shadow:0 2px 4px #00000026;content:"";height:3px;left:1px;max-width:20px;position:absolute;width:30%}.c-header{background:#f8a51b;box-shadow:0 2px 8px #63636333;position:sticky;top:0;transition:all .2s ease-in-out;z-index:1000}.c-header .header{display:flex;height:64px;justify-content:space-between}.c-header .header *{color:#fff;font-family:Zen Maru,Han Rounded;font-size:18px;font-weight:700;text-shadow:-1px 2px 4px rgba(0,0,0,.25)}.c-header .header .c-logo{aspect-ratio:1;height:100%}.c-header .header nav{align-items:center;display:flex;gap:45px;margin:20px}.c-header .header nav .nav-button{position:relative}.c-header .header nav .nav-button .arrow-icon{transition:transform .3s ease-in-out}.c-header .header nav .nav-button .rotate{transform:rotate(180deg)}.c-nav-drawer{height:100dvh;left:0;position:absolute;top:0;width:100dvw}.c-nav-drawer .nav-drawer{align-items:center;background-color:#fff;background-image:url(../image/background/home-2.webp);background-position-x:center;background-position-y:bottom -300px;background-size:cover;display:flex;flex-direction:column;height:100%;max-width:85dvw;padding:10px;position:fixed;top:0;width:300px;z-index:inherit}@media screen and (min-width:540px){.c-nav-drawer .nav-drawer{padding:20px;width:360px}}.c-nav-drawer .nav-drawer .list{display:flex;flex-direction:column;gap:15px;height:100%;margin:60px;width:100%}@media screen and (min-width:540px){.c-nav-drawer .nav-drawer .list{gap:30px}}@media screen and (min-width:800px){.c-nav-drawer .nav-drawer .list{gap:40px}}.c-nav-drawer .nav-drawer .c-booking-action{display:flex;flex-direction:column;margin:30px 0;width:100%}.is-pinned{background-color:#f8a51b!important;box-shadow:0 2px 8px #63636333!important}.fixed,.transparent-bg{background-color:initial}.fixed{box-shadow:none;position:fixed;width:100%}.c-language-menu *{color:#000;font-family:Zen Maru,Han Rounded}.c-subnav{border-radius:15px!important}.c-subnav *{color:#fff;font-weight:700!important;text-shadow:-1px 2px 4px rgba(0,0,0,.25)}.primary-background{background-color:#f8a51b;border-radius:0 0 15px 15px!important}body[data-v-675e06ec],html[data-v-675e06ec]{margin:0;padding:0;scroll-snap-stop:always;width:100%}*[data-v-675e06ec]{box-sizing:border-box}.h1[data-v-675e06ec]{color:#000;font-family:Montserrat,You Se;font-size:48px}@media screen and (min-width:340px){.h1[data-v-675e06ec]{font-size:64px}}@media screen and (min-width:540px){.h1[data-v-675e06ec]{font-size:72px}}.h2[data-v-675e06ec]{color:#000;font-family:Montserrat,You Se;font-size:36px}@media screen and (min-width:340px){.h2[data-v-675e06ec]{font-size:48px}}@media screen and (min-width:540px){.h2[data-v-675e06ec]{font-size:64px}}.h3[data-v-675e06ec]{color:#000;font-family:Montserrat,You Se;font-size:28px;font-weight:800}@media screen and (min-width:340px){.h3[data-v-675e06ec]{font-size:36px}}@media screen and (min-width:540px){.h3[data-v-675e06ec]{font-size:48px}}.h4[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ded;font-size:24px;font-weight:700}@media screen and (min-width:340px){.h4[data-v-675e06ec]{font-size:28px}}@media screen and (min-width:540px){.h4[data-v-675e06ec]{font-size:36px}}.h5[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ded;font-size:22px;font-weight:700}@media screen and (min-width:340px){.h5[data-v-675e06ec]{font-size:24px}}@media screen and (min-width:540px){.h5[data-v-675e06ec]{font-size:28px}}.h6[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ded;font-size:20px;font-weight:700}@media screen and (min-width:340px){.h6[data-v-675e06ec]{font-size:22px}}@media screen and (min-width:540px){.h6[data-v-675e06ec]{font-size:24px}}.subtitle1[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ded;font-size:18px;font-weight:700}@media screen and (min-width:340px){.subtitle1[data-v-675e06ec]{font-size:20px}}@media screen and (min-width:540px){.subtitle1[data-v-675e06ec]{font-size:22px}}.subtitle2[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ded;font-size:16px;font-weight:700}@media screen and (min-width:340px){.subtitle2[data-v-675e06ec]{font-size:18px}}@media screen and (min-width:540px){.subtitle2[data-v-675e06ec]{font-size:20px}}.body1[data-v-675e06ec]{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:14px}@media screen and (min-width:340px){.body1[data-v-675e06ec]{font-size:16px}}@media screen and (min-width:540px){.body1[data-v-675e06ec]{font-size:18px}}.body2[data-v-675e06ec]{color:#5e5e5e;font-family:Roboto,Helvetica Neue,Fang Zheng,Helvetica,Arial;font-size:12px}@media screen and (min-width:340px){.body2[data-v-675e06ec]{font-size:14px}}@media screen and (min-width:540px){.body2[data-v-675e06ec]{font-size:16px}}.highlight[data-v-675e06ec]{color:#f8a51b!important;font-weight:700}.card[data-v-675e06ec],.v-select__content[data-v-675e06ec]{border-radius:20px!important;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a!important}.card *[data-v-675e06ec],.v-select__content *[data-v-675e06ec]{color:#5e5e5e;font-family:Zen Maru,Han Rounded;font-weight:700}.card .v-list-item--active *[data-v-675e06ec],.v-select__content .v-list-item--active *[data-v-675e06ec]{color:#000!important}.v-list[data-v-675e06ec]{background-color:transparent;padding:5px 0}.v-list a[data-v-675e06ec]{border-radius:50px;margin:5px 10px}.c-section-subheader[data-v-675e06ec]{background-color:#f8a51b;border-radius:16px;box-shadow:0 4px 4px #00000026,inset 0 4px 4px #0000001a;padding:6px 30px 8px;width:-moz-fit-content;width:fit-content}@media screen and (min-width:800px){.c-section-subheader[data-v-675e06ec]{border-radius:20px;padding:8px 45px 10px}}.c-section-subheader h2[data-v-675e06ec]{color:#fff;font-weight:900;line-height:120%;text-align:left}@keyframes fadeOut-675e06ec{0%{opacity:0;transform:scale(.5)}to{opacity:1;transform:scale(1)}}.c-bottom[data-v-675e06ec]{align-items:center;display:flex;font-size:14px;justify-content:center;text-align:center}.c-bottom .copyright[data-v-675e06ec]{color:#5e5e5e;padding:10px 0}footer[data-v-675e06ec]{background-image:url(../image/background/footer.webp);background-position:bottom;background-size:cover;position:relative;z-index:100}footer[data-v-675e06ec]:after{background:radial-gradient(circle,#ffffffb3 60%,#fff3);background-size:cover;content:"";height:100%;position:absolute;top:0;width:100%;z-index:-5}.c-footer[data-v-675e06ec]{align-items:center;display:flex;flex-direction:column;z-index:100}@media screen and (min-width:1280px){.c-footer[data-v-675e06ec]{flex-direction:row;height:240px;justify-content:space-between;padding-top:30px}}.c-footer *[data-v-675e06ec]{font-family:Zen Maru,Han Rounded}.c-footer .c-logo[data-v-675e06ec]{padding-top:30px;width:140px}@media screen and (min-width:800px){.c-footer .c-logo[data-v-675e06ec]{width:180px}}@media screen and (min-width:1280px){.c-footer .c-logo[data-v-675e06ec]{padding-right:120px;width:320px}}.c-footer .c-footer-info[data-v-675e06ec]{flex:1}@media screen and (min-width:1280px){.c-footer .c-footer-info[data-v-675e06ec]{border-left:2px solid #000;padding-left:90px}}.c-footer .c-footer-info address[data-v-675e06ec]{align-items:center;display:flex;flex-wrap:wrap;gap:10px 60px;justify-content:center;padding:20px 0 15px}@media screen and (min-width:1280px){.c-footer .c-footer-info address[data-v-675e06ec]{justify-content:unset;padding:0}}.c-footer .c-footer-info address a[data-v-675e06ec]{align-items:center;color:#000;display:flex;font-style:normal;gap:20px;text-decoration:none;text-shadow:-1px 2px 4px rgba(0,0,0,.25)}.c-footer .c-footer-info address a span[data-v-675e06ec]{font-weight:700}.c-footer .c-footer-info address .phone span[data-v-675e06ec]{font-family:Montserrat,You Se;font-weight:600}.c-footer .c-footer-info address .email[data-v-675e06ec]{align-items:flex-end}.c-footer .c-footer-info h5[data-v-675e06ec]{align-items:center;display:flex;flex-direction:column;font-family:Montserrat,You Se;margin-bottom:10px;margin-top:20px;position:relative}@media screen and (min-width:800px){.c-footer .c-footer-info h5[data-v-675e06ec]{align-items:unset}}.c-footer .c-footer-info h5[data-v-675e06ec]:after{background-color:#000;border-radius:100px;bottom:-2px;content:"";height:3px;position:absolute;width:40px}@media screen and (min-width:800px){.c-footer .c-footer-info h5[data-v-675e06ec]:after{left:0}}.c-footer .c-footer-info nav[data-v-675e06ec]{align-items:center;display:flex;flex-direction:column;gap:10px 40px;margin:20px 0}@media screen and (min-width:800px){.c-footer .c-footer-info nav[data-v-675e06ec]{flex-direction:row}}.c-footer .c-footer-info nav div[data-v-675e06ec]{align-items:center;display:flex;flex-wrap:wrap;gap:10px 40px;justify-content:center}@media screen and (min-width:800px){.c-footer .c-footer-info nav div[data-v-675e06ec]{justify-content:flex-start}}.c-footer .c-footer-info nav div a[data-v-675e06ec]{font-size:18px;font-weight:700;text-shadow:-1px 2px 4px rgba(0,0,0,.25);white-space:nowrap}.c-language-menu *[data-v-675e06ec]{color:#000;font-family:Zen Maru,Han Rounded}
